Ever feel like you and your partner argue about the same thing over and over again? You’re not alone. 69% of relationship conflicts never actually get solved—but that doesn’t mean your relationship is broken.

In this episode, I sit down with Julie Sharon-Wagschal, a Dutch-American psychologist and certified Gottman therapist, to talk about why couples keep getting stuck in the same fights and what they can do about it. We dive into the Dreams Within Conflict exercise, a powerful tool that helps partners see what’s really behind those ongoing arguments—because most of the time, it’s not just about the dishes or how you spend the holidays.
